What are Soffits and Guttering?

Soffits

Soffits are the underside of architectural features, typically found underneath the eaves of a roof. They bridge the space in between the roof overhang and the wall of your home, offering an ended up look while likewise serving useful functions.

Guttering

Guttering, or rain gutters, are channels or troughs installed along the roof's edge that collect rainwater and direct it far from your house. This avoids water from pooling around the structure, which can lead to considerable structural damage gradually.

Types of Soffits

Soffits come in different products and designs. Here are the most typical types:

Vinyl Soffits

  • Pros: Low maintenance, readily available in numerous colors, resistant to rot and insects.
  • Cons: Limited insulation residential or commercial properties compared to wood.

Wood Soffits

  • Pros: Aesthetic appeal, strong resilience, good insulation.
  • Cons: Requires regular upkeep (painting, sealing), susceptible to rot if not well-kept.

Aluminum Soffits

  • Pros: Lightweight, rust-resistant, easy to install.
  • Cons: Can damage quickly, offered in fewer colors than vinyl.

Fiber Cement Soffits

  • Pros: Highly resilient, resistant to weather and fire, simulates the appearance of wood.
  • Cons: Heavier and can be more pricey to install.

Types of Guttering

Similar to soffits, seamless gutters likewise come in various materials and designs:

Seamless Gutters

  • Pros: Custom-fitted to your home, lower leakages, more visually appealing.
  • Cons: Higher installation cost, requires expert setup.

K-Style Gutters

  • Pros: Popular choice, provides a modern appearance, holds more water than half-round seamless gutters.
  • Cons: Can collapse under heavy snow or ice load.

Half-Round Gutters

  • Pros: Traditional look, less prone to clogs.
  • Cons: Generally hold less water, might need more frequent cleaning.

Box Gutters

  • Pros: Can deal with large volumes of water, perfect for commercial structures.
  • Cons: Can be more complicated to install, higher upkeep needed.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

1. How often should gutters be cleaned?

It is advisable to clean rain gutters at least twice a year-- normally in the spring and fall. Homes near trees or heavy foliage might need more frequent cleaning.

2. What indications indicate that soffits and rain gutters need changing?

Indications that your soffits and rain gutters might require replacement include noticeable damage (fractures, rot, denting), water pooling near the foundation, and insect infestations.

3. Can I install soffits and seamless gutters myself?

While DIY setup is possible, hiring experts is suggested. They have the knowledge to ensure that the setups are correctly aligned and safely connected.

4. Are there energy-efficient choices for soffits?

Yes, setting up insulated soffits can help manage attic temperature levels, potentially minimizing heating & cooling costs.
